Privacy policy
The short version
Stowsee keeps everything on your phone. The app has no account, no server of its own, and no analytics. It never sends your photos, descriptions, or catalog anywhere unless you export them yourself.
What the app stores, and where
Stowsee stores the photos you take, the descriptions you type or dictate, your boxes, locations, tags, and settings in the app's private storage on your device. Android prevents other apps from reading that storage. Uninstalling Stowsee deletes it.
What leaves your phone
- Backups and exports are files you create on purpose and save to a location you pick, such as a folder, a USB drive, or a cloud drive app. Where that file goes, and who can read it, is up to you and the service you chose.
- Printing sends the label sheet or inventory to the print service you select on your phone.
- Nothing else. Stowsee does not contact any server, does not use analytics or crash reporting, and shows no ads.
Permissions
- Camera, to photograph items and scan QR labels. Photos are saved only to the app's own storage.
- Microphone, only while you dictate a description or a search. See the next section.
- Stowsee does not ask for your location, contacts, or access to your photo gallery.
Dictation
Dictation uses the speech recognizer built into your phone. On phones with an offline speech model, recognition happens on the device. On phones without one, the phone's recognizer may send audio to its provider (usually Google) under that provider's privacy terms. Stowsee itself never records, stores, or transmits audio. You can always type instead.
Appearance search
Searching by description compares your words to your photos using a model that is bundled with the app and runs on the phone. Your photos are not uploaded for this.
Optional sync server
Stowsee may in future connect to a sync server so a household can share one catalog. Using it is optional. If you connect the app to a server, the boxes and items you choose to share are sent to that server, either one you run yourself or one we operate under separate terms that will be shown before you sign in. Without a server configured, Stowsee sends nothing.
